The Burmester 3D ambient light upgrade for Mercedes Benz W206 (C Class 2021–present) enhances the model’s premium interior with lighting that complements its evolved design language. Specifically engineered for the W206’s curved dashboard and door panel architecture, this 3D system uses contour following LED strips and micro projectors to create depth—light appears to emanate from behind trim pieces, avoiding flatness. It integrates with the W206’s MBUX 2.0, offering 64 colors and "Sound Visualization" that maps Burmester audio output to light patterns on the dashboard. Unique to the W206 is "Navigation Link," where 3D light flows toward upcoming turns, enhancing spatial awareness. Installation uses the sedan’s existing trim clips and wiring channels, preserving factory fit, with modules tested to withstand the W206’s stricter vibration standards. Materials include recycled aluminum bezels, aligning with Mercedes’ sustainability goals. Regional variants prioritize: brighter outputs for Northern Europe, warmer tones for China, sportier red accents for AMG Line trims in the U.S. This upgrade modernizes the W206’s cabin, bridging its tech forward design with a sensory experience worthy of its luxury positioning.
